Vrednotenje vpliva kozmetičnih izdelkov s sirotko na izbrane parametre kože

Abstract
Na področju kozmetologije je vse bolj aktualna uporaba kozmetično aktivnih sestavin (KAS) biološkega izvora, med katere uvrščamo tudi proteine in peptide. Obenem kozmetična industrija v ospredje postavlja skrb za okolje in sledi trendom t. i. industrije »brez odpadkov«. V skladu s to usmeritvijo in upoštevajoč načelo krožnega gospodarstva je aktualna možnost uporabe velike količine sirotke, ki predstavlja odpadni material in s tem močno obremenjuje okolje. Sirotka se je že v preteklosti uporabljala za nego kože in las, zato je bil glavni namen pričujoče diplomske naloge izdelati kozmetične izdelke (KI) s sirotko in ovrednotiti njihov vpliv na izbrane parametre kože in vivo. V okviru diplomske naloge smo izdelali dva različna kozmetična izdelka s tekočo sirotko, in sicer šampon za lase in čistilni hidrogel, ter njune učinke na kožo vrednotili v sklopu raziskave in vivo na 10 prostovoljkah, ki jo je odobrila Komisija Republike Slovenije za medicinsko etiko. Med raziskavo smo se osredotočili na ključne kazalnike funkcije kože: transepidermalno izgubo vode, hidratacijo kože, eritemski in melaninski indeks ter sijaj kože. Izdelali smo dva različna sistema, tj. šampon in čistilni hidrogel, oba z vgrajeno sirotko in brez nje. Bazalne vrednosti omenjenih parametrov smo primerjali z vrednostmi parametrov po enkratnem nanosu (20 minut) posamezne formulacije. Rezultati so pokazali, da formulacije s sirotko zmanjšajo transepidermalno izgubo vode, kar odraža izboljšano barierno funkcijo kože. Obe formulaciji brez vgrajene sirotke sta pozitivno vplivali na hidratacijo kože, sirotka pa je stopnjo hidratacije še dodatno izboljšala. Šampon z vgrajeno sirotko ali brez nje ni značilno vplival na eritemski indeks, kar potrjuje, da ne povzroča draženja kože, prav tako ni bilo razlik v melaninskem indeksu. Razlik v sijaju kože pri uporabi čistilnega hidrogela z vgrajeno sirotko ali brez nje nismo zaznali. Na podlagi rezultatov lahko potrdimo ugoden vpliv sirotke na barierno funkcijo in hidratacijo kože ter njen potencial za nadaljnje formuliranje, razvoj in vrednotenje kot kozmetično aktivne sestavine izdelkov za nego kože.

Title:Evaluation of whey-based cosmetic products' effect on selected skin parameters
Abstract:
In the field of cosmetology, the use of cosmetically active ingredients of biological origin, which also include proteins and peptides, is becoming increasingly popular. At the same time, the cosmetics industry is putting environmental concerns in the spotlight and following the trend of "zero waste" industry. In accordance with this approach and considering the principle of circular economy, the current possibility of linking the cosmetics and dairy industries is being considered. Large quantities of whey, a byproduct of milk processing, are produced, which is a waste material and thus puts a strain on the environment. Whey has been used for skin and hair care in the past, so the main purpose of this thesis was to develop cosmetic products with whey and evaluate their impact on selected skin parameters in vivo. As part of the thesis, we developed two different cosmetic products with liquid whey, namely a hair shampoo and a face cleansing hydrogel, and evaluated their effects on the skin in an in vivo study on 10 female volunteers, with the approval of the Slovenian Medical Ethics Committee. During the study, we focused on key indicators of skin function: transepidermal water loss skin hydration, erythema index, melanin index and skin gloss. We developed two different systems, a shampoo and a hydrogel, both with and without integrated whey. We compared the baseline values of the mentioned parameters with the values of the parameters after a single application (20 min) of each formulation. The results showed that whey formulations reduced transepidermal water loss, reflecting an improved skin barrier. Both formulations without whey had a positive effect on skin hydration, and whey further improved the level of hydration. Shampoo with or without built-in whey did not have a significant effect on erythema index, confirming that it does not cause irritation, also no differences in melanin index were observed. We did not detect any differences in skin brightness when using a cleansing hydrogel with or without built-in whey. Based on the results, we can confirm the beneficial effect of whey on the barrier function and hydration of the skin, as well as its potential for further formulation and evaluation as a cosmetic active ingredient in skin care products.
